UL 10362 PFA Wire — 250°C / 600V High-Temperature Internal Wiring
Melt-Processable PFA Insulation Combining 250°C Performance with Thin-Wall Flexibility
UL Style 10362 is a single-conductor appliance wiring material (AWM) insulated with extruded PFA (perfluoroalkoxy) fluoropolymer, rated for 250°C continuous operation at 600V AC. Recognized under UL Subject 758, the style covers conductor sizes from 30 AWG to 4/0 AWG in solid or stranded construction. PFA shares the same upper temperature rating as PTFE, but unlike tape-wrapped PTFE it is melt-processable — allowing a thin, dimensionally uniform insulation wall and noticeably better flexibility. UL 10362 Specification Summary
- Style Number: UL 10362 (AWM, UL 758)
- Temperature Rating: 250°C continuous
- Voltage Rating: 600V AC
- Flame Rating: Horizontal flame
- Conductor Range: 30 AWG – 4/0 AWG, solid or stranded
- Insulation Material: Extruded PFA (perfluoroalkoxy)
- Min. Insulation Wall (30–10 AWG): 10 mils average / 8 mils at any point (≈ 0.25 mm / 0.20 mm)
- Min. Insulation Wall (9–2 AWG): 30 mils average / 27 mils at any point
- Min. Insulation Wall (1–4/0 AWG): 45 mils average / 41 mils at any point
- Conductor Options: Bare or tinned copper
- UL Status: UL Recognized Component — file on record
- Intended Use: Internal wiring of appliances and electronic equipment

Conductor & Dimension Reference
The values below cover the most commonly specified hook-up range. AWG is the primary sizing reference, with metric cross-section shown for convenience. Final dimensions follow the production datasheet on a per-order basis.
| Gauge (AWG) | Cross-Section (mm²) | Stranding | Ins. Wall (mm) | Nom. OD (mm) | Max. Resistance (Ω/km) |
|---|---|---|---|---|---|
| 26 AWG | 0.13 | 7/0.16 | 0.25 | 0.95 | 145.0 |
| 24 AWG | 0.20 | 7/0.20 | 0.25 | 1.10 | 89.4 |
| 22 AWG | 0.33 | 7/0.25 | 0.25 | 1.30 | 57.6 |
| 20 AWG | 0.52 | 19/0.18 | 0.25 | 1.50 | 36.4 |
| 18 AWG | 0.82 | 19/0.23 | 0.25 | 1.75 | 23.2 |
| 16 AWG | 1.31 | 19/0.29 | 0.25 | 2.05 | 14.6 |
Typical Application Environments
The pairing of 250°C thermal endurance with a thin, flexible wall makes UL 10362 PFA wire the preferred internal lead in equipment where both heat and routing constraints matter:
- Industrial heaters and thermal processing equipment: Lead wiring inside the heated zone holds full dielectric strength at sustained 250°C, well above the limit of PVC, XLPE, or FEP.
- Sensors, thermocouples, and instrumentation: The thin, uniform PFA wall keeps outer diameter small in dense sensor harnesses while surviving repeated heat cycling without embrittlement.
- Semiconductor and vacuum equipment: PFA’s extremely low outgassing and zero plasticiser content suit cleanroom and vacuum-chamber wiring where trace contamination is unacceptable.
- Chemical and laboratory instruments: The non-porous fluoropolymer surface resists acids, alkalis, solvents, and fuels, and tolerates autoclave and solvent-wipe cleaning cycles.
- Lighting ballasts and ignition assemblies: Compact high-temperature internal wiring requiring a flexible, abrasion-tolerant 250°C lead in a confined enclosure.
UL 10362 vs Related High-Temperature Styles
Buyers specifying a 250°C internal wire routinely weigh PFA, PTFE, FEP, and silicone against one another. The table below covers the four UL AWM styles most often compared with UL 10362:
| UL Style | Insulation | Temp | Voltage | Key Characteristic vs UL 10362 |
|---|---|---|---|---|
| 10362 (this page) | PFA | 250°C | 600V | Melt-processable thin wall + 250°C; best balance of heat, flexibility, and uniformity |
| 1659 | PTFE | 250°C | 600V | Same temp; higher abrasion resistance but stiffer and tape-wrapped rather than extruded |
| 1332 | FEP | 200°C | 300V | Similar processing to PFA but 50°C lower and half the voltage; lower unit cost |
| 3135 | Silicone | 200°C | 600V | Greater flexibility and lower cost, but thicker wall and 50°C lower ceiling |
